We have an exciting opportunity for a Paid Media Assistant to join our Performance Marketing team. This role plays a vital part in the success of Harrods’ marketing initiatives and offers an opportunity to work within a prestigious and dynamic organisation.

About the Role

The Paid Media Assistant is integral in supporting the execution of effective paid media campaigns across various digital platforms to drive online visibility, customer engagement, and revenue generation. By assisting in the planning, implementation, and optimisation of paid media strategies, the Paid Media Assistant contributes to enhancing Harrods’ brand presence in the digital landscape and ensures that our advertising efforts align with business objectives.

You will be supporting the Paid Media and Digital Marketing team, and will be working holistically across many areas of the business. You will collaborate with key stakeholders to gather campaign information with the aim of clearly communicating and sharing information campaign detail with relevant internal teams and external agencies.

You will coordinate campaign checks (QA checking) post launch and communicate campaign status to senior management. You will be accountable for reporting and analysing campaign performance across specified metrics, and assist with budget and invoice management. You will be able to help identify marketing trends and opportunities for innovation. Above all, you will be supporting  the Paid Media and Digital Marketing team with administrative tasks.

About You

You will have a passion for digital marketing and staying up to date with the latest industry trends. You will be enthusiastic, organised and self-motivated with strong attention to detail. You will have a collaborative approach and an ability to interact with cross-functional teams. You will have excellent written and verbal communication skills, with experience across Microsoft Office suite.
